D. The Operation Test
SUBTASK 24-34-00-710-001
(1) Do an operational check of the Standby Power system as follows:
(a) Make sure the BAT switch on the P5-13 panel is set to the ON position.
(b) Make sure the STANDBY POWER switch on the P5-5 panel is set to the AUTO position.
(c) Make sure the STANDBY PWR OFF light on the P5-5 panel is off.
(d) Set both the AC meter selector switch and the DC meter selector switch on the P5-13
panel to the STBY PWR position.
(e) Make sure the AC meter shows these values:
1) AC VOLTS = 110-120
2) CPS FREQ = 395-405
(f) Make sure the DC meter shows this value:
1) DC VOLTS = 20-28
(g) Set the STANDBY POWER switch on the P5-5 panel to the OFF position.
(h) Make sure the STANDBY PWR OFF light on the P5-5 panel comes on.
(i) Make sure the AC meter shows these values:
1) AC VOLTS = 0
